This document provides an overview of a course on principles of software engineering. The course will cover 60 contact hours and include topics like the software development life cycle, agile development, requirements engineering, modeling with UML, structured coding techniques, software testing, and software maintenance. Students will be evaluated internally on 20 marks and externally on 80 marks. The objectives are to learn engineering practices in software development. Prerequisites include basic programming knowledge. Recommended textbooks and references are also provided.

Course Overview
O Number of Contact Hours: 60 Hrs.
O Course Evaluation: Internal – 20 Marks +
External – 80 Marks
O Objectives:
O To learn engineering practices in Software
Development
O Prerequisites:
O Basic programming Knowledge
Software Engineering Basics
O In this course we are going to cover
O Software Engineering Overview
O Software Development Life Cycle
O Agile Development
O Requirements Engineering
O Modelling with UML
O Structured Coding Techniques
O Software Testing Overview
O Software Maintenance
Text Books
O Roger S, “Software Engineering – A
Practitioner’s Approach”, seventh edition,
Pressman, 2010.
O Pearson Education, “Software Engineering
by Ian Sommerville”, 9th edition, 2010.
O Roff: UML: A Beginner’s Guide TMH
References
O Hans Van Vliet, “Software Engineering: Principles
and Practices”, 2008.
O Richard Fairley, “Software Engineering
Concepts”, 2008.
O RohitKhurana, Software Engineering: Principles
and Practices, 2nd Edition, Vikas Publishing
House Pvt Ltd.
O PankajJalote, An Integrated Approach to
Software Engineering, 3rd Edition, Narosa
Publishing House.
O Alhir, learning UML, SPD/O’Reily
